The final amount for your new floors depends on a few specific things. First, it comes down to the material you choose, whether that is hardwood, luxury vinyl, or carpet. The size of the area being covered and how much prep work the subfloor needs will also play a role. If your rooms have complex layouts or lots of corners, that often adds labor time. For Bellevue homes, luxury vinyl plank (LVP) is a top choice. It handles moisture well, which is great given the local climate. LVP also mimics the look of hardwood or tile without the maintenance. It's durable and can stand up to daily wear and tear. You can get a free quote on installing LVP by calling us.
In Bellevue, look for dullness, scratches, or worn-out finishes on your hardwood floors. If you see uneven color or water stains that won't wipe away, it's likely time for refinishing. You might also notice that the floor feels rougher than it used to. Refinishing brings back the original beauty and protects the wood. We can help you find a pro for this service.
Porcelain tile is an excellent choice for bathrooms in Bellevue. It's highly water-resistant and durable, making it ideal for areas prone to moisture. Porcelain also offers a wide range of styles, from mimicking natural stone to wood looks. It's easy to clean and maintain. Call us to get a quote for bathroom tile installation.

For a modern Bellevue aesthetic, consider lighter stains like natural or white oak. These stains enhance the wood grain and create an airy feel. Medium tones like honey or walnut can also work well, offering warmth without being too dark. The key is choosing a stain that complements your home's overall design. A pro can advise on the best stain for your floors.
